Texas Instruments TMS570LS1227 16/32-Bit RISC Flashマイクロコントローラ

Texas Instruments TMS570LS1227 16/32ビットRISCフラッシュ・マイクロコントローラ(MCU)は、安全システムを対象とした高性能の車載マイクロコントローラです。安全アーキテクチャには、ロックステップでのデュアルCPU、CPUとメモリBISTロジック、フラッシュとデータSRAMの両方でのECC、周辺メモリでのパリティ、周辺I/Oでのループバック機能があります。TMS570LS1227デバイスには、効率的な1.66 DMIPS/MHzが備わったARM Cortex-R4F浮動小数点CPUが集積されており、最大298DMIPSを実現している180MHzまで動作可能な構成があります。このデバイスは、ビッグエンディアン[BE32]形式に対応しています。

TMS570LS1227には、1.25MBの集積フラッシュと192KBのデータRAMがあり、シングルビットエラー訂正とダブルビットエラー検出が備わっています。このデバイスのフラッシュメモリは、不揮発性で電気的に消去可能なプログラマブルメモリです。64ビットの広いデータバスインターフェイスが実装されています。このフラッシュは、すべての読取、プログラミング、消去動作を対象とした3.3V供給入力(I/O供給と同じレベル)で動作します。パイプライン・モードの場合、フラッシュは、最大180MHzのシステム・クロック周波数で動作します。SRAMは、対応する周波数範囲全体で、バイト、ハーフワード、ワード、ダブルワード・モードでの単一サイクルの読取と書込アクセスをサポートしています。

TMS570LS1227は、リアルタイム制御ベースのアプリケーションを対象とした周辺機器、最大44個のI/O端子が搭載された2基の次世代ハイエンドタイマ(N2HET)タイミング・コプロセッサ、最大14の出力、7基の拡張パルス幅変調器(ePWM)モジュール、6基の拡張キャプチャ(eCAP)モジュール、2基の拡張直交エンコーダパルス(eQEP)モジュール、最大24の入力に対応している2基の12ビット・アナログ・デジタル・コンバータ(ADC)が搭載されています。

統合安全機能と通信と制御周辺機器の広い選択肢があるTexas Instruments TMS570LS1227は、安全性が重要である要件を持つ高性能リアルタイム制御アプリケーションに最適なソリューションです。

特徴

  • 安全性が重要なアプリケーションを対象とした高性能車載グレードマイクロコントローラ
    • LockStepでのデュアルCPU実行
    • フラッシュとRAMインターフェイスでのECC
    • CPU用の内蔵自己テスト(BIST)とオンチップラムス
    • エラーピン搭載エラー信号モジュール
    • 電圧とクロックモニタリング
  • Arm® Cortex- R4F 32ビットRISC CPU
    • 8段パイプラインで1.66DMIPS/MHz
    • シングルおよびダブル精度が備わったFPU
    • 12領域メモリ保護ユニット(MPU)
    • サードパーティのサポートがあるオープンアーキテクチャ
  • 動作条件
    • 最高180MHzのシステムクロック
    • コア供給電圧(VCC): - 1.14V~1.32V
    • I/O供給電圧(VCCIO):- 3.0V~3.6V
  • 統合メモリ
    • プログラム・フラッシュ(ECC搭載):1.25MB
    • ECCで192KBのRAM
    • エミュレートされたEEPROM用の64KBのフラッシュ(ECC対応)
  • 16ビット外部メモリインターフェイス(EMIF)
  • 共通プラットフォームアーキテクチャ
    • ファミリ全体での一貫したメモリマップ
    • リアルタイム割り込み(RTI)タイマ(OSタイマ)
    • 128チャンネルベクトル割り込みモジュール(VIM)
    • 2チャンネル対応巡回冗長検査(CRC)
  • ダイレクトメモリアクセス(DMA)コントローラ
    • 16チャンネルと32の制御パケット
    • 制御パケットRAMのパリティ保護
    • 専用MPUによって保護されたDMAアクセス
  • 内蔵スリップ検出器が搭載された周波数変調位相ロックループ(FMPLL)
  • 独立した非変調PLL
  • IEEE 1149.1 JTAG、バウンダリ・スキャン、ARM CoreSight™コンポーネント
  • 高度なJTAGセキュリティモジュール(AJSM)
  • キャリブレーション機能
    • パラメータオーバーレイモジュール(POM)
  • 割り込みを生成する能力がある16本の汎用入力/出力(GPIO)ピン
  • モータ制御用の強化されたタイミング周辺機器
    • 7基の拡張パルス幅変調 (ePWM) モジュール
    • 6つの拡張キャプチャ(eCAP)モジュール
    • 2つの拡張直交エンコーダパルス(eQEP)モジュール
  • 2つの次世代ハイエンドタイマ(N2HET)モジュール
    • N2HET1 - 32のプログラマブルチャンネル
    • N2HET2 - 18のプログラマブルチャンネル
    • それぞれパリティ保護が備わった160ワード命令RAM
    • 各N2HETには、ハードウェア角度発生器を搭載
    • それぞれのN2HET専用のハイエンド・タイマー転送装置(HTU)
  • 2基の12ビット・マルチバッファADCモジュール
    • ADC1 - 24チャンネル
    • ADC1と共有のADC2 - 16チャンネル
    • 64の結果バッファ(パリティ保護あり)
  • 複数の通信インターフェイス
    • 10/100MbpsイーサネットMAC(EMAC)
      • IEEE 802.3準拠(3.3V I/Oのみ)
      • MII、RMII、MDIOに対応
    • 2チャンネル搭載FlexRayコントローラ
      • パリティ保護を備えた8KBのメッセージRAM
      • 専用FlexRay転送装置(FTU)
    • 3台のCANコントローラ(DCAN)
      • それぞれにパリティ保護が備わった64のメールボックス
      • CANプロトコルバージョン2.0Aおよび2.0Bに準拠
    • 集積回路間(I2C)
    • 3つのマルチバッファ・シリアル・ペリフェラル・インターフェイス(MibSPI)モジュール
      • 各128ワード(パリティ保護あり)
      • 8つの転送グループ
    • 最大2つの標準シリアル・ペリフェラル・インターフェイス(SPI)モジュール
    • UART (SCI) インターフェイス2台、そのうちの1台にはローカル・インターコネクト・ネットワーク(LIN 2.1)インターフェイスサポートあり
  • パッケージ
    • 144ピン・クワッド・フラットパック(PGE)[Green]
    • 337ボール・グリッド・アレイ(ZWT)[Green]

アプリケーション

  • ブレーキシステム(ABS / ESC)
  • 電動パワーステアリング(EPS)
  • HEVおよびEVインバータシステム
  • バッテリ管理システム(BMS)
  • アクティブ運転支援システム(ADAS)
  • 航空宇宙と航空電子工学
  • 鉄道通信
  • オフロード車

機能ブロック図

ブロック図 - Texas Instruments TMS570LS1227 16/32-Bit RISC Flashマイクロコントローラ
公開: 2021-03-25 | 更新済み: 2022-03-11